The Experience in Detail
Ease of Booking and Transportation
Starting with the logistics, booking this tour is straightforward—most travelers book about 11 days in advance, citing a good balance of planning without last-minute stress. The tour includes hotel pickup and drop-off, which is a huge plus, especially if you’re staying in popular areas like Kuta or Seminyak. The vans are air-conditioned, ensuring you stay comfortable on the short drive to Benoa Harbour, where the adventure begins.
The boat ride itself is on the Bali Hai II catamaran, which gets many reviews praising its comfort, entertainment options like live music, and the inclusion of snacks and drinks. The trip across the sea takes roughly an hour, during which you can enjoy ocean breezes and spectacular views of Bali’s coastline, setting a relaxing tone for the day ahead.

Arrival and Activities
Upon arrival at Nusa Lembongan, the focus shifts to the private Beach Club—a cozy, well-equipped spot with gardens, pools, and plenty of activities. Many reviewers say that once on the island, most of the day revolves around this area. You’ll have access to snorkeling equipment, sea kayaks, and the lagoon pools, perfect for both relaxing and active water play.
One guest mentioned, “The beach club was nice, great cocktails, and BBQ lunch,” emphasizing the quality of the food and the laid-back yet lively environment. The lunch buffet includes grilled fish, salads, sausages, and desserts, and is repeatedly praised for its taste and variety. The organizers seem to strike a good balance between offering a hearty meal and allowing guests to continue enjoying the water and sun afterward.
Water Activities Galore
Water lovers will find plenty to do. The tour includes unlimited banana boat rides and snorkeling equipment—many reviews highlight just how much fun they had. One reviewer said, “Snorkeling was fantastic—really clear water, colorful fish, and coral,” which shows the quality of the underwater experience.
For those interested in a bit more adventure, optional activities like parasailing, scuba diving, and semi-submersible viewing are available for an extra cost. Be aware that some reviews point out that the underwater environment may vary—one reviewer noted, “The scuba diving was disappointing; not many things to see underwater.” Still, the snorkeling and semi-submarine options receive high praise.

FAQs

How long does the entire tour last?
The tour lasts approximately 7 hours, starting with hotel pickup around 8:00 am and concluding with drop-off back at your hotel.
Is hotel pickup included?
Yes, pickup and drop-off are included from major Bali hotels in Kuta, Seminyak, Sanur, Jimbaran, and Nusa Dua.
What water activities are included?
Guests enjoy unlimited banana boat rides, snorkeling equipment, sea kayaks, and the lagoon pools—activities that cater to various comfort and thrill levels.
Can I purchase additional activities?
Yes, optional activities like parasailing, scuba diving, and massages are available for extra costs—payable directly at the site.
Is lunch included?
A BBQ buffet with grilled fish, salads, and more is included, and many guests consider it both delicious and plentiful.
Are there any environmental concerns?
Some reviews mention that the ocean water can be affected by trash, which may impact snorkeling quality. It’s worth being mindful of environmental preservation and possibly bringing your own water and towels.
What should I bring?
Bring your passport or ID, swimwear, towels (some places charge for towels), sunscreen, and perhaps some cash for optional extras or souvenirs.
Are there any age restrictions?
Most travelers of all ages can participate, and the tour is considered family-friendly.
How is the organization of the day?
Most guests find the day very well organized, with smooth transitions between activities, punctual pickups, and friendly guides.
